Steps to Create a Meaningful Funeral Slideshow

1. Gather Photos and Videos

Start by collecting photos and videos that capture the essence of your loved one’s life. Reach out to family and friends for contributions. Aim for a mix of images that reflect different stages of life and key milestones.

2. Choose a Theme

Select a theme that resonates with your loved one’s personality or interests. This could be based on their hobbies, career, or favorite colors. A cohesive theme helps in creating a more engaging slideshow.

3. Select Music

Music adds an emotional layer to your slideshow. Choose songs that were meaningful to your loved one or that evoke cherished memories. Ensure the music aligns with the theme and tone of the service.

4. Use a Funeral PowerPoint Template

Utilize a funeral PowerPoint template to streamline the design process. Templates offer a structured format, making it easier to organize photos and text.

5. Arrange the Slides

Organize the slides in a chronological order or by themes such as family, friends, hobbies, and achievements. Keep each slide simple with minimal text to let the photos and videos speak for themselves.

6. Add Captions and Quotes

Incorporate captions and quotes to provide context or share sentiments. Use quotes that reflect your loved one’s beliefs or favorite sayings.

7. Review and Edit

Once your slideshow is assembled, review it for flow and coherence. Edit any slides that feel out of place and ensure transitions are smooth.

Tips for a Successful Funeral Slideshow

  • Keep It Concise: Aim for a slideshow duration of 10-15 minutes to maintain engagement.
  • Test Equipment: Ensure all equipment is working properly before the service.
  • Have a Backup: Prepare a backup copy of the slideshow on a USB drive or cloud storage.
  • Practice: Run through the slideshow to familiarize yourself with the transitions and timing.

FAQs about Funeral PowerPoint Slideshows

  1. What is the ideal length for a funeral slideshow? – Typically, 10-15 minutes is ideal to keep the audience engaged.
  2. Can I include videos in the slideshow? – Yes, incorporating short video clips can enhance the emotional impact.
  3. How many photos should I include? – Aim for 60-80 photos to create a balanced and engaging slideshow.
  4. What type of music should I choose? – Select music that was meaningful to your loved one or that fits the tone of the service.

  6. How can I ensure the slideshow runs smoothly during the service? – Test all equipment in advance and have a backup copy ready.
  7. Can I create the slideshow myself? – Absolutely. With the right tools and templates, you can create a beautiful tribute on your own.
  8. What software should I use? – Microsoft PowerPoint is commonly used, but other options like Google Slides or Apple Keynote are also suitable.
  9. How do I add captions to my slides? – Use the text box feature in your slideshow software to add captions and quotes.
  10. Is it okay to include humorous photos? – Yes, including light-hearted photos can celebrate the joyful moments of your loved one’s life.
